What Are Aluminum Bottle Closures?


Aluminum bottle closures are metal caps designed for bottles, primarily crafted from aluminum. These closures are not just practical; they are integral to maintaining product integrity and safety. Engineered for a variety of applications, aluminum closures can serve as a barrier against contamination, leakage, and, importantly, counterfeiting. Their durable nature and customizable designs make them a preferred choice across various industries, including beverages, pharmaceuticals, and cosmetics.

How Aluminum Bottle Closures Function in Anti-Counterfeiting


Aluminum bottle closures utilize several innovative features designed to prevent tampering and counterfeiting. Below are key functions that enhance their effectiveness:

1. Tamper-Evident Seals


One of the most significant characteristics of aluminum closures is their tamper-evident seals. These seals ensure that any unauthorized access to the product is immediately apparent, providing consumers with confidence that the product is safe for use.

2. Customization and Serialization


Aluminum closures can be customized with unique designs, colors, and branding. Furthermore, serialization allows for the inclusion of barcodes or QR codes that can be scanned to verify authenticity, enabling a direct link between the product and the manufacturer.

3. Integration with Smart Technologies


Many aluminum closures incorporate smart technology, such as NFC (Near Field Communication) chips, which allow consumers to verify the authenticity of the product through their smartphones. This integration represents a significant step forward in consumer engagement and brand protection.

Benefits of Using Aluminum Closures in Packaging


The use of aluminum closures offers numerous advantages that extend beyond mere aesthetics and functionality. Here are some of the key benefits:

1. Durability


Aluminum is resistant to corrosion and degradation, making it an ideal material for packaging. This durability ensures that products remain safe from external factors, further safeguarding against counterfeiting.

2. Environmental Responsibility


Aluminum is recyclable, which contributes to a more sustainable packaging solution. Brands that adopt aluminum closures demonstrate a commitment to environmental responsibility, appealing to eco-conscious consumers.

3. Cost-Effectiveness


While the initial investment in aluminum closures may be higher than plastic alternatives, the long-term benefits—such as reduced product returns and enhanced brand loyalty—often outweigh the costs.

Industry Applications of Aluminum Bottle Closures


Aluminum closures are utilized across various industries, each benefiting from their unique properties:

1. Beverage Industry


In the beverage sector, aluminum closures are commonly used for soft drinks and alcoholic beverages. Their tamper-evident features and ability to maintain carbonation make them a preferred choice.

2. Pharmaceutical Sector


Pharmaceutical companies rely on aluminum closures to ensure the integrity and safety of their products. The ability to provide clear tamper evidence is crucial in maintaining consumer trust.

3. Cosmetics and Personal Care


Cosmetic brands use aluminum closures to enhance their packaging aesthetics while ensuring that products are protected against counterfeiting, which is prevalent in the beauty industry.
